Background:
The Norwich Bioscience Institutes are a cluster of internationally renowned research organisations, working to tackle major challenges of the 21st Century - the sustainability of our environment, our food supplies and healthy ageing.
The NBI Partnership provides high quality, non-scientific support services for the diverse community of staff, students and visiting workers at the Institutes (the Earlham Institute, John Innes Centre, The Sainsbury Laboratory and Quadram Institute Bioscience), their subsidiaries and for the NBI Partnership.
Based on the Norwich Research Park, you will be joining a committed, professional and welcoming team. In addition, you will enjoy a competitive salary and annual leave, our defined contribution pension scheme, excellent recreational facilities and a range of other employee benefits.
The Finance department is responsible for dealing with all finance matters for the main organisations on site and other subsidiary companies. Financial services provided include Management Accounts, Petty Cash, Expense Claims, Budgeting and Grant Accounting. They also deal with all Statutory Accounting, VAT and Taxation issues.
